While it was all tied up 15-15 at halftime, Calhoun Falls Charter was not quite Ware Shoals's equal in the second half on Wednesday. They fell just short of the Ware Shoals Hornets by a score of 37-35. The Blue Flashes were not able to repeat the success they had when they faced the Hornets earlier this season, when they won 69-37.

When it comes to explaining why Calhoun Falls Charter lost, don't look at Autumn Thomas. Despite the final result, she posted 24 points. Thomas' evening made it three games in a row in which she has scored at least 20 points. Alexis Sanders was another key player, putting up five points and three blocks.
Ware Shoals found their leader in sophomore Stella Eichhorn, who dropped a double-double with 18 points and 15 rebounds. Eichhorn is crushing it when it comes to boards: she's pulled down at least nine every time she's taken the court this season. Another player making a difference was Kaylee Watts, who scored nine points.
Calhoun Falls Charter's loss dropped their record down to 14-6. As for Ware Shoals, their victory was their third straight on the road, which pushed their record up to 11-11.
